Ticket SC-448: Recipe-scaling calculator in Ladlefox rounds fractional yields incorrectly below half-batch sizes. Fix applies banker's rounding and clamps minimum yield to one serving. Unit tests added for metric and imperial paths. Contractor notes: do not touch the ingredient-substitution module; it's out of scope. Needs sign-off before merge to release branch. Approver is named below.

account owner for bawip-tahag: Raleth Quenok

Subject: On-call handover — Pedalshift rebalancer

Hi Soren,

Handing over Pedalshift on-call. The rebalancing planner is stable, but the plugin API for third-party depot optimizers changed last Tuesday: hooks now receive dock capacity as a float, and several external plugin authors haven't updated yet. Expect tickets about crashed optimizer runs. The compatibility shim in release 4.2 covers most cases; point authors at the migration guide in the docs portal. If plugin authors need direct help beyond the guide, have them write to us here.

escalation mailbox, hahag-yagaf: ralir@paliqhq.test

## Formula sandbox tuning

User-supplied formulas in Gridmoor execute inside a restricted interpreter with hard ceilings on time, memory, and call depth. Reviewers should confirm any change to these ceilings is justified in the PR description, since raising them widens the abuse surface. Defaults were chosen from production traces. The current limits are as follows.

limits module of tafog-fawip:
WEIGHTS = {
    "julix": 57,
    "lamys": 992,
    "kasvan": 209,
    "quenok": 750,
    "alddor": 259,
    "oliath": 1009,
    "wenix": 815,
}

Ticket: Vault lockout on Framewick transcode farm. The credentials vault for the render nodes auto-locked after three failed unseal attempts during Tuesday's restart. Transcoding jobs are queuing but not dispatching. Future maintainers: do not re-initialize the vault; unseal it manually using the recovery passphrase recorded immediately below this ticket body.

vault phrase of yagag-kadup = belael-druius-rusax-kelox